WBC eventualities, tiebreakers: How can USA, different groups advance?

As the 2023 World Baseball Classic is about to wrap up pool play on Wednesday, three spots are nonetheless up for grabs for the quarterfinals. 

In Pool C, the United States, Canada and Mexico every have 2-1 information and are in a three-way tie on the prime whereas Colombia is 1-2 and Great Britain is 1-3. 

In Pool D, Venezuela is off to a 3-0 begin and has already clinched its ticket to the quarterfinals. Puerto Rico and the Dominican Republic are in second and third place, respectively, with every having a 2-1 report. Israel is third at 1-2 and Nicaragua is fourth at 0-4. 

For Pool D, development eventualities are fairly easy. With Venezuela already punching its ticket, Wednesday’s Puerto Rico-Dominican Republic sport is win-and-advance. The dropping crew is eradicated. 

But for Pool C, issues would possibly get difficult. Mexico and Canada face one another within the ultimate sport of pool play, so the winner of that sport will advance. The United States takes on Colombia, and if the USA wins, it advances to the subsequent spherical. 

If the United States loses, although, three groups will end with a 2-2 report in Pool C and just one can advance. You would possibly suppose the United States can be robotically secure contemplating its positive-nine-run differential getting into Wednesday, however run differential is not used as a tiebreaker in any respect within the World Baseball Classic.

Instead, there are a couple of completely different doable tiebreaking eventualities that is likely to be a bit complicated and require some math.

The first multi-team tiebreaker is the bottom quotient of runs allowed divided by the variety of defensive outs recorded in video games between the groups which can be tied. So the crew that gave up the fewest variety of runs per defensive out in video games towards the opposite two groups will advance.

The first tiebreaker was really utilized in Pool A, with all 5 groups going 2-2. Cuba gave up 15 runs over 108 defensive outs, serving to it advance, and Italy had the second-best quotient to let it advance to the quarterfinals. 

If one crew in Pool C stands above the remainder after that tiebreak, it advances. If two groups are tied, then the head-to-head outcome between these two groups will decide who advances.

If all three groups maintain the same variety of runs allowed divided by defensive outs recorded, the same technique will probably be used for the second tiebreak. Instead of complete runs allowed, it is the variety of earned runs allowed per every defensive out recorded towards the opposite two groups that may decide who advances.

If all three groups are nonetheless tied after the second tiebreak, the crew with the best batting common within the video games towards the 2 different groups will advance.

If that in some way is not sufficient to find out who advances, there will probably be a drawing of heaps between the tied groups.
